Noah Copeland To Participate In NCAA Men's Swimming Championships This Weekend

March 27, 2008

FEDERAL WAY, Wash. – Georgia Tech junior Noah Copeland is competing in the NCAA Men’s Swimming and Diving Championships this weekend at the Weyerhaeuser King County Aquatic Center in Federal Way, Wash. He will be swimming the 100-free and 200-free events at the meet which is co-hosted by the Seattle Sports Commission and University of Washington.

“This is going to be a very fast meet but I know Noah will take the challenge,” head coach Stu Wilson said. “He’s looking forward to competing against the best in the country and in the world.”

The 200-free will take place Friday, March 28 while the 100-free will be on Saturday, March 29. Fans can follow Copeland and the entire meet with live video at: http://www.swimmingworldmagazine.com/lane9/news/17595.asp. Live stats will also be available at http://ncaaswim.com/men08/.

At last month’s ACC Championships, Copeland set new school records in the 100-free (43.87) and 200-free (1:35.79) while being named an All-ACC performer for each event.
